Coming soon: NIAAA funding for NADIA research resource (U24) on adolescent drinking and adult brain-behavior outcomes

NIAAA plans to release a U24 collaborative NOFO for the NADIA consortium to study how adolescent alcohol exposure causes lasting changes in brain development and adult behavior. This forecast is to help teams form collaborations and plan responsive projects; applications are not being accepted yet. Clinical trials are not allowed.

The National Institute on Alcohol Abuse and Alcoholism (NIAAA) intends to publish a Notice of Funding Opportunity (NOFO) to solicit applications for research on the Neurobiology of Adolescent Drinking in Adulthood (NADIA) consortium to elucidate mechanisms of persistent changes in brain-be…
